Github上Pandas,Numpy和 Scipy三个库中20个最常用的函数

2016-11-11 01:06 阅读(756)    评论(0)   

几个月前,我看到一篇博客中列出了 Github 网站上 Python 常用库中使用频率最高的一些函数/模块。我在这个基础上做了可视化处理,并撰写了每个库中使用频率前十的函数示例。其中本文中只包含了部分示例,完整的示例可以参见我的 Github。

首先我利用 requests 和 BeautifulSoup 从原始博客中爬取相关的数据,然后利用 matplotlib 和 seaborn 来绘制条形图,其中函数的排序由包含该函数的资源库(Repositories)数目所决定。比如,虽然 pd.Timestamp 的总频次特别高,但是该函数仅在少量的资源库中出现,所以它的排序相对靠后。

Pandas

1

 

DataFrame: 创建一个 dataframe 对象

2

merge:联结两个 dataframe

3

4

Numpy

5

arange: 创建某个区间内等间距的序列数组

6

mean: 沿着某个轴向计算列表/数组中所有数据的平均数7

Scipy8

stats: 常用的统计函数或分布函数910

linalg: 常用的线性代数函数,如逆矩阵(linalg.inv)、行列式(linalg.det)

11

interpolate: 样条函数和插值函数

12

13

signal: 包含信号处理工具

14

15

 

misc: misc.imread 和 misc.imsave 分别用于读取和保存图像数据1617

最后谢谢各位的阅读,你可以在我的 Github中看到完整的函数示例。

公司二维码

原文链接:https://galeascience.wordpress.com/2016/08/10/top-10-pandas-numpy-and-scipy-functions-on-github/
原文作者:Alexander Galea
译者:Fibears

分享到:

相关推荐

  • 9c2f4aa9-106b-4633-a61c-d64b6bf0d26a_w_00600

    制造了无数恐怖事件,这位毒枭却被老百姓尊为救世主,竟还差点当上总统

    如何实现一夜暴富,除了中彩票外还有另一个办法——寻宝。 2015年,哥伦比亚的一名农夫就在一处田野里,直接挖出了10大桶现金,足足有6亿美金。 经警方推测,这巨额的现金正是世纪大毒枭巴勃罗·埃斯科瓦尔留下的“秘密宝藏”。 巴勃罗是历史上最大的毒枭,极其夸张地曾靠贩卖可卡因登上了世...

  • 22

    它们自愿成为啃垃圾的人类朋友,却因“爱心”沦为了只有皮囊的玩物

    时常能见到三五户人家带着自家的金毛、哈士奇、泰迪、萨摩耶、阿拉斯加,聚在一起讨论养狗的趣事。 每种狗都有着特别的体态特征,有时候反差可以很大。 2007年的吉尼斯世界纪录日,两位有趣的记录保持者在美国加利福尼亚州相见。 最高的狗Gibson和最矮的狗BooBoo首次相见,BooBoo还不足G...

  • 8

    他们的飞机朝飓风心脏长驱直入,用生命换来数据对抗灾难

    人们常将消防员的救灾的背影比喻为“最帅的逆行”。 但在天灾面前,还有一种同样悲壮的“逆行”却鲜为人知。 继4级飓风“哈维”袭击美国后,5级飓风“艾玛”也蓄势待发,准备登陆美国。 随着预警颁布,弗罗里达州已全线进入紧急状态,超市很快被抢售一空。 然而,就在所有人都选择撤离和避险...

评论 抢沙发

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址

SME 发掘你不知道的科技故事